What is the Orga AI API?
The Orga AI API enables real-time interaction with our AI model Orga, allowing your applications to stream user video+audio or audio-only while receiving low-latency audio responses. Powered by WebRTC for bidirectional media and WebSocket/HTTPS for control messages (authentication, parameters, events), it simplifies building AI-driven conversations. Developers can use it directly with a backend proxy or through our SDKs for streamlined integration.

cURL QuickstartThis guide helps developers test and set up the Orga AI API for real-time WebRTC sessions by fetching client secrets and ICE servers using cURL. Use the cURL scripts to test /v1/realtime/client-secrets and /v1/realtime/ice-config or adapt them into a backend proxy for secure integration with the /v1/realtime/calls endpoint, which requires a WebRTC-capable environment (browser or mobile app).
